Charged phone during long flight, and read a lot. After landing, fingerprint sensor was like 50%. Reboot, no improvement. Menu for fingerprint settings...click and lag, nothing. Reboot. Now fingerprint menu is gone. So is home button!

PITA....got Leedrod tweaks for Navbar! Dirty flash, and no fp sensor. Clean flash, no fp sensor. Restore stock system and wipe data...doesn't even ask for fingerprint on setup. It's like the hardware disappeared. Tried force stop fingerprint software from settings, apps, show system, and clear data. Reboot again...gone.

Wakeup next day, reboot and it works? So flash Leedroid, and restore my Nandroid data...all good now.

So what can cause the loss of the hardware like this? Some kind of security lockout? Or hardware fault? Didn't get wet. Still in 30 day period...should I send it back?
